When it comes to baking food in an oven, there are some potential health benefits that should be considered. Baked foods tend to have fewer calories and less fat than foods that are fried or cooked in oil, which makes them better for people who are trying to watch their weight or maintain a healthy diet. Additionally, baking can retain more of the nutrients from ingredients like vegetables, since they aren’t exposed to high temperatures for long periods of time.
However, baking can also be unhealthy when done incorrectly. If too much fat or sugar is added during the baking process, then this can increase the calorie count significantly and make the food less healthy overall. Additionally, if the oven isn’t set at the correct temperature or if baked goods are left in for too long, then this can cause them to burn and lose some of their nutritional value.
Conclusion
Overall, baking food in an oven can be a healthy way to prepare meals if done correctly. As long as you avoid adding too much fat or sugar, use fresh ingredients and keep an eye on your dishes while they’re cooking, you will be able to enjoy all the nutritional benefits that come with baking your own food.
